Student Activities 2007 - 2011
Mill Valley High School May 11, 2007
The Student Council Elections for 2007-2008 were held on the Touch Screen machines with some 600 student body members voting. The students elected Student Council officers of President, Vice-President and Treasurer plus each class elected their class officers and representatives. The Election Office sent two Supervising Judges. They were assisted by students assigned to help as Election Workers.
Wheatridge Middle School and Gardner High School May 15 – 16, 2007
Students at both Wheatridge Middle and Gardner High School (eighth grade at the middle school through juniors at the high school) were eligible to vote on Student Council officers for the school year 2007-2008. Student Council officers plus class officers were voted on by some 1142 students on the Touch Screen machines. The Election Office sent two Supervising Judges who supervised the students assigned to serve as Election Workers.
Central Elementary School October 1, 2007
Central Elementary School had their Student Council Election for 2007 with 140 students plus teachers eligible to vote. They voted on Council President, Vice-President, Secretary and Treasurer. Students third grade through sixth grade voted on the candidate selections on the Touch Screen Machines. Students were assigned to assist the two Supervising Judges sent by the Election Office.
Bishop Miege High School April 30. 2009
Bishop Miege High School had Student Council Election Day on April 30, 2009 with 700 students plus up to 100 faculty members eligible to vote on the Touch Screen Machines. The officers elected for the 2009-2010 school year were Student Council President, Vice-President, Secretary and Treasurer. The Election Office provided two Supervising Judges. Bishop Miege provided several students to assist with the process.
